In a world grappling with the tumult of early 20th-century modernity, "The Poet Assassinated" by Guillaume Apollinaire captures the essence of an era marked by artistic revolution and existential inquiry. This novel intricately weaves the life of Croniamantal, a character who embodies the struggle between creativity and societal constraints. Through its unique blend of whimsy and satire, the narrative challenges readers to reflect on the nature of identity and the impact of art amidst chaos.
